Our very own analyses mean that the latest resiliency, image, and you will redundancy of your own rusty patched bumble-bee have all refused once the later 1990’s as they are estimated to carry on so you can refuse along side second numerous ages. Usually, the varieties is abundant and you can extensive, with hundreds of communities across an expansive variety, and you may is actually the latest fourth-rated Bombus kinds within relative abundance study. Because detailed over, the rusty patched bumble-bee try broadly marketed historically across the East All of us, top Midwest, and you will south Quebec and you can Ontario, an area comprising 15 ecoregions, 29 Says/Provinces, and you will 394 U

Typically, the latest rusty patched bumble bee could have been recorded of 926 communities; due to the fact 1999, the fresh new varieties could have been noticed on 103 communities, and therefore is short for an 88 percent decline from the quantity of populations documented before 2000). I presumed one populace having a minumum of one number (someone rusty patched bumble-bee viewed) given that 1999 is actually most recent, which means that, the entire health insurance and reputation ones 103 current populations is actually not sure. Actually, of several populations have not been reconfirmed because very early 2000s and you will ple, no rusty patched bumble bees was seen from the 41 (forty %) of latest sites as 2010 and at 75 (73 per cent) of your 103 websites just like the 2015. In addition, a number of the current communities is actually noted by only a few individuals; 95 % of communities was reported by 5 or less individuals; maximum amount available at people website is actually 30. Just how many somebody constituting proper nest is usually numerous hundred or so, and you may a wholesome society typically include tens to help you numerous territories (Macfarlane mais aussi al. 1994, pp. 34).

Plus the death of populations, a marked reduced total of the range and you may distribution has occurred in recent years. S. areas and you may 38 condition-alternatives for the Canada. Because 2000, the brand new species’ shipping keeps rejected across the its variety, which have newest information regarding six ecoregions, 14 Claims otherwise Provinces, and you can 55 counties (profile step one); this represents an 87-% loss of spatial the amount (indicated just like the a loss of areas with the varieties) inside the historical range. The fresh new losings in the number of populations and spatial extent give the fresh rusty patched bumble bee at risk of extinction also rather than next outside stresses ( elizabeth.g., environment losings, insecticide coverage) pretending abreast of the brand new species.

Pathogens -The brand new precipitous decline of a lot bumble-bee varieties (for instance the rusty patched) throughout the mid-90s to the current is contemporaneous to your collapse for the populations regarding theoretically bred western bumble bees ( B. occidentalis), elevated primarily to pollinate greenhouse tomato and sweet pepper harvest, originating in the later mid-eighties (such as for example, Szabo ainsi que al. 2012, pp. 232233). It collapse are related to the fresh microsporidium (fungus) Nosema bombi. Around the same go out, several North american insane bumble-bee variety also started initially to , p. 232). bombi about commercial territories to wild populations through mutual foraging resources. Patterns away from losses noticed, yet not, can not be entirely informed me by exposure to Letter. bombi. Numerous experts has actually surmised you to definitely N. bombi is almost certainly not the fresh culpable (or only culpable) pathogen throughout the precipitous erica (like, Goulson 2016, persm.; Uncommon and you will Tripodi 2016, persm.), while the proof to own persistent pathogen spillover off commercial bumble bees due to the fact a main factor in decline stays debatable (see individuals arguments when you look at the Colla et al. 2006, entire; Szabo mais aussi al. 2012, entire; Manley et al. 2015, entire).
